New Zealand fishermen land a colossal squid that lives up to the name

Colossal squid aren't the same as giant squid. They're much heavier. In this case, much, much heavier (an estimated 450 kg, which means about 990 pounds!).

In the linked article, the BBC provides a size comparison chart, using a London bus as a starting point. The squid is longer.

For those of you into specifics, the squid in question is said to be a Mesonychoteuthis hamiltoni, and it was found in Antarctic waters.
